G. E. Rumphius; Large folio, Slipper Lobsters - 1711
Scarce folio in hand colour from Georg Eberhard Rumpf’s D'Amboinsche Rariteitkamer. The work included engravings of crustaceans, shells, and sea urchins.

Folio engraving.

Later hand coloured.

Published in 1711.

Rumpf was a botanist and naturalist. He joined the military branch of the Dutch East India Company in 1652, and from there he devoted his life to the study of natural history in Moluccas, Indonesia.
